The Swiss format will be used at the ELEAGUE Major Main Qualifier and in the group stage at the ELEAGUE Major. A tweet by the VP of ELEAGUE revealed that the Swiss format will be used in the ELEAGUE Major Main Qualifier taking place from December 15-18. ELEAGUE Major's group stage will also use the same format in the group stage, which will be the first time that it is used at a Major. The Swiss-system was used in the previous Major Main Qualifier which took place in Katowice before ESL One Cologne. ELEAGUE Major Main Qualifier, featuring sixteen teams, will continue using the same format.
At the ESL One Cologne Main Qualifier, all of the sixteen competing teams were in the same group and after the predetermined initial matches, teams with the same record who have not played against one another squared off. Three losses resulted in elimination and three wins guaranteed a spot at the Major. Whether the ELEAGUE Major itself will feature a sixteen-team or two eight-team Swiss groups is not yet clear but we will update you when the information becomes available.
